#a43d0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a43d0d is composed of 64.3% red, 23.9%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.8% magenta, 92.1%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 19.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 34.7%. #a43d0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a1a with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#a43d0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a43d0d has RGB values of R:164, G:61,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.92,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10763533.

Shades and Tints of #a43d0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fef2ed is the lightest one.
